UEFA charge Rangers with improper conduct

Rangers have been charged by UEFA with the improper conduct of their supporters following the disturbances during the Champions League match against Unirea Urziceni. The case will be dealt with by UEFA's control and disciplinary body next Thursday. Television pictures showed a number of Rangers fans clashing with Romanian police in the stands, while one supporter was seen to rip out a seat.

No H1N1 vaccines, or re-scheduled matches: Platini

European football chief Michel Platini said Thursday he would not take measures that would force players involved in European competition to be vaccinated against swine flu, or the H1N1 virus. And the former France and Juventus midfield legend added that UEFA would not postpone any Champions League or Europa League matches in the event several players in a team had contracted the virus. Arsenal ’still one of Europe’s elite’

Arsenal are still one of the best teams not only in the Premier League but in Europe, according to Arsene Wenger. The Frenchman recently became Arsenal’s longest-serving manager and still believes his side are up there with the best, despite never winning the UEFA Champions League.
